Navigating Your Financial Future with Edward Jones

Edward Jones is a financial services firm specializing in personal finance and investment management. Established in 1922 by Edward D. Jones in St. Louis, Missouri, the company has expanded to include more than 19,000 financial advisors throughout the United States and Canada. The firm’s primary objective is to assist individual investors in achieving their financial goals through customized service and investment strategies. Edward Jones distinguishes itself from larger financial institutions by focusing on individual clients rather than institutional investors, providing personalized guidance to help clients manage their financial planning needs. The company’s operational philosophy centers on developing enduring client relationships as a foundation for effective financial advising. Edward Jones advisors typically conduct in-person meetings with clients, which helps establish trust and understanding that may be challenging to develop through digital interactions alone. This dedication to personal service is embedded in the firm’s business model, with an emphasis on maintaining local offices and community involvement. By concentrating on individual investors and their specific financial situations, Edward Jones has positioned itself as a reliable financial partner for millions of clients.

Setting Financial Goals with Edward Jones

Setting financial goals is a foundational step in any successful financial plan, and Edward Jones places significant emphasis on this process. The firm encourages clients to articulate their aspirations clearly, whether they involve saving for a home, funding a child’s education, or preparing for retirement. Financial advisors at Edward Jones utilize a comprehensive approach to help clients identify both short-term and long-term goals.

This involves not only discussing monetary objectives but also understanding the underlying motivations and values that drive these goals. For instance, a client may wish to save for a vacation home. An Edward Jones advisor would delve deeper into this desire, exploring what the vacation home represents—perhaps it’s a place for family gatherings or a retreat from daily life.

By understanding the emotional significance behind financial goals, advisors can create more meaningful and effective strategies. Additionally, Edward Jones employs various tools and resources to assist clients in quantifying their goals, ensuring they are realistic and achievable within a specified timeframe. This structured approach helps clients maintain focus and motivation as they work towards their financial aspirations.

Creating a Personalized Financial Plan with Edward Jones

Once financial goals are established, the next step is to create a personalized financial plan tailored to each client’s unique situation. Edward Jones advisors take a holistic view of an individual’s finances, considering income, expenses, assets, liabilities, and risk tolerance. This comprehensive analysis allows them to develop a customized strategy that aligns with the client’s objectives while also addressing potential challenges.

The process begins with an in-depth consultation where advisors gather information about the client’s current financial status and future aspirations. This may include discussions about investment preferences, tax considerations, and any existing financial products the client may have. Based on this information, the advisor crafts a detailed financial plan that outlines specific steps to achieve the client’s goals.

For example, if a client aims to retire comfortably in 20 years, the plan might include recommendations for retirement accounts, investment allocations, and savings strategies designed to maximize growth while managing risk.

Investing for the Future with Edward Jones

Investing is a critical component of any financial plan, and Edward Jones offers a wide array of investment options tailored to meet diverse client needs. The firm emphasizes the importance of understanding market dynamics and individual risk tolerance when constructing an investment portfolio. Advisors at Edward Jones work closely with clients to educate them about various investment vehicles, including stocks, bonds, mutual funds, and exchange-traded funds (ETFs).

This educational approach empowers clients to make informed decisions about their investments. Moreover, Edward Jones employs a disciplined investment philosophy that focuses on long-term growth rather than short-term speculation. Advisors often recommend a diversified portfolio that balances risk across different asset classes.

For instance, a client with a moderate risk tolerance might have a mix of equities for growth potential and fixed-income securities for stability. Additionally, Edward Jones provides ongoing market insights and research to help clients stay informed about their investments and make adjustments as needed. This proactive approach ensures that clients are not only investing wisely but also adapting their strategies in response to changing market conditions.

Retirement planning is one of the most critical aspects of financial advising at Edward Jones. As individuals approach retirement age, the need for a well-structured plan becomes paramount to ensure financial security during their golden years. Edward Jones advisors guide clients through the complexities of retirement planning by assessing their current savings, expected expenses in retirement, and desired lifestyle choices.

This comprehensive evaluation helps clients understand how much they need to save and invest to achieve their retirement goals. One of the key tools used in retirement planning is the analysis of various retirement accounts such as 401(k)s, IRAs, and Roth IRAs. Advisors at Edward Jones help clients navigate the intricacies of these accounts, including contribution limits, tax implications, and withdrawal strategies.

For example, they may recommend maximizing contributions to employer-sponsored plans while also considering additional savings in individual retirement accounts. Furthermore, Edward Jones emphasizes the importance of creating a sustainable withdrawal strategy during retirement to ensure that clients do not outlive their savings. This involves projecting future expenses and income sources to develop a realistic plan for drawing down assets over time.

Education Planning with Edward Jones

Education planning is another vital service offered by Edward Jones, particularly for clients who wish to fund their children’s or grandchildren’s education. The rising costs of higher education can be daunting, making it essential for families to start planning early. Edward Jones advisors assist clients in exploring various education savings options such as 529 plans and Coverdell Education Savings Accounts (ESAs).

These accounts offer tax advantages that can significantly enhance savings over time. In addition to discussing specific savings vehicles, Edward Jones advisors help families set realistic education funding goals based on projected tuition costs and other related expenses. For instance, if a family aims to save for their child’s college education starting from birth, an advisor would calculate how much needs to be saved monthly to reach that goal by the time the child turns 18.

This forward-thinking approach not only alleviates financial stress but also instills a sense of responsibility in children regarding education and finances.

Estate and Legacy Planning with Edward Jones

Estate planning is an often-overlooked aspect of financial management that Edward Jones addresses comprehensively. Advisors work with clients to ensure that their assets are distributed according to their wishes after they pass away while minimizing tax implications for heirs. This process involves creating wills, trusts, and other legal documents that outline how assets should be managed and distributed.

Edward Jones emphasizes the importance of discussing legacy goals with clients—what they want their legacy to be and how they wish to be remembered. This conversation often leads to considerations beyond mere asset distribution; it may include charitable giving or establishing family foundations. Advisors guide clients through these discussions, helping them articulate their values and intentions clearly.

By integrating estate planning into the overall financial strategy, Edward Jones ensures that clients’ wishes are honored while providing peace of mind for both them and their families.

Reviewing and Adjusting Your Financial Plan with Edward Jones

The financial landscape is dynamic; therefore, regular reviews and adjustments of financial plans are crucial for long-term success. Edward Jones encourages clients to schedule periodic check-ins with their advisors to assess progress toward their goals and make necessary adjustments based on life changes or market conditions. These reviews provide an opportunity to revisit financial objectives, evaluate investment performance, and discuss any new developments in the client’s life that may impact their financial situation.

For example, if a client experiences a significant life event such as marriage or the birth of a child, it may necessitate changes in their financial plan. An advisor at Edward Jones would help recalibrate savings goals or adjust investment strategies accordingly. Additionally, market fluctuations can affect portfolio performance; thus, regular reviews allow for timely adjustments that align with the client’s risk tolerance and investment objectives.

By fostering an ongoing relationship built on communication and trust, Edward Jones ensures that clients remain on track toward achieving their financial aspirations while adapting to life’s inevitable changes.
